女性が優れたプログラマーになる理由

画像

リンダ・リュカスは、アルバート・ゴア専用のサイトを作るためのプログラミングを独自に学んだ



ミニチュアブロンドの26歳の女の子が最も才能のあるプログラマーの1人になるとは想像していなかったでしょう。 しかし、ヘルシンキ(フィンランド)のLinda Liukasは、自分自身を料理やランニングが好きな人、「子供向けの本が多すぎる」人だと言っていますが、それでも彼女はそうです。 彼女は、227か国で働き、プログラミングに女性を引き付けるためのグローバルなイニシアチブの作成に参加し、すでに子どもたちにプログラミングの方法を教える一連の本を書いて説明しています。 「女性は優れたプログラマーです。なぜなら、彼らは創造的な人々であると同時に、うまくコミュニケーションをとる方法を知っているからです」と彼女はロンドンでの技術会議で会ったときに私に説明します。



社交的で魅力的なLiucasは、コードライティングを視覚的で創造的な芸術として再発見した才能のあるプログラマーと見なされています。 彼女は、 Codecademy Webサイトの最初の従業員の1人で、1,000万ドルの投資を受け、無料のプログラミングレッスンを提供しました。 その後、2010年に、彼女は非営利組織Rails Girlsの顔になりました。RailsGirlsは、女性にWebアプリケーションの作成を訓練します。



画像

LiucasのHello Rubyのイラストは、子どもたちのプログラミングへの関心を刺激するはずです



当初、Rails Girlsは友人向けの週末学習コースでした。彼女は、Ruby on Railsの使用を全員に教えることで、プログラミングの謎を打ち破りたかったのです。 「このツールを使用すると、視覚的でリアルなものを非常に迅速に作成できます」とLiucas氏は言います。 「大丈夫です。」 Rails Girlsのレッスンはオンラインだけでなく、実生活でも行われました。 ボランティアのおかげで機能しているこの組織には、すでにドイツからモザンビークの国々で、世界中で11〜65歳の10,000人の女性が含まれています。 「プログラマのコミュニティとコミュニケーションをとらない普通の人は、コードがコンピューター用のコンピューターによって書かれていると信じていますが、そうではありません」と彼女は言います。 -コードは人のために人によって書かれています。 これは非常に人間的なことです。」



リウカスはヘルシンキで育ち、彼氏と一緒に住んでいます。 彼女の父親は財務部長、母親は中央商工会議所で働いていました。 2001年、13歳で彼女はアイドル専用のWebサイトを作成することにしました。 「それはオーランド・ブルームではなかった」と彼女は笑う。



画像



「アルゴアに夢中だった! 彼は大統領選挙の部外者でした。 彼はブッシュほど丁寧ではなかったが、環境に非常に興味があった。」 彼女はホルスに関するすべてをグーグルで検索し、彼をデジタル崇拝の場にすることを決めました。 「ゼロからプログラミングを学ぶ必要がありました。 しかし、私は何からも何かを作成できることを知りました。そして、このために私は言葉以外何も必要としません。 コンピューターに必要なすべてのことを実行させることができることに気付いたときの気持ちを覚えています。」



その後、プログラミングのレッスンは単純すぎて、想像もせずに行われました。 「私は週に2時間勉強しました。 それほど速くはなく、私は30人のクラスの3人の女の子のうちの1人でした。」 Liucasは、教師がジャワでテディベアを描くように彼女に要求した方法を思い出します。 「クマを手で描いたり、Photoshopで描いたりするのは、コードを使うよりもずっと良かったからです。 先生は、1000匹のクマまたは200匹の異なる色のクマを描く必要がある場合に役立つと説明しませんでした。 文脈を教えてくれませんでした。」 彼女は、基本を学ぶのに10年近く費やさなければならないと言います。



彼女の両親は経済学者であり、同じことをするように勧めましたが、彼女は視覚ジャーナリズムをより好んでいました。 アールト大学(ヘルシンキ)では、学生はスタンフォード大学で1年間の研究を提供され、リューカスは製品設計を勉強するためにそこに行きました。 そこで彼女はプログラミングレッスンに登録し、Rubyを発見しました。Rubyは彼女のキャリアの道を変えました。 1993年に松本幸宏によって作成されたLiukasは、「深い人間」の言語が好きで、コードに人間の特徴を与え始めました。 「苦労したとき、Rubyという名前の6歳の少女にそれらを説明していると想像し、説明的な絵を描きました。」



彼女は自分の絵をTumblrに投稿し、人々はRubyが次に何をするのかと尋ね始め、子供向けの本全体を作成するようにアドバイスする人もいました。 大いに興奮して、リンダは最初の草案を書き始めました。 Hello Rubyは、スマートで遊び心のある赤毛の少女が魔法の宝石のコレクションを失い、それらを取り戻す旅に出発する技術とプログラミングの本です。 途中で、Rubyは孤独なユキヒョウ、おしゃべりなアンドロイドのグループ、ファイアーフォックス、パーティーオーガナイザー、賢いペンギンと力を合わせます。







彼女の本の出版に資金を提供するために、リンダは昨年1月にKickstarterでクラウドファンディングキャンペーンを開始ました 。 「最初の500冊をカバーすることになっていた10,000ドルを求めました。 24時間で、100,000ドル以上を獲得しました。 キャンペーンの終わりまでに、380,000ドルを受け取りました。 それは私の人生を完全に変えました。」



彼女のキャンペーンが有名になると、マクミランはリンダに米国で一連の本を作成する契約を申し出ました。 彼女の編集者は彼女の物語を拡大するのを助けました-今ではそれは3倍長くなり、追加の練習帳がそれに添付されています。 英国では、彼女は別の契約を待っています。 本の書き直しのためにプロジェクトは遅れていますが、リンダは彼女の支持者がすべてを理解していると言い、彼女はブログの助けを借りて彼らを更新し続けます。



画像



彼女はキャンペーンの成功を、「子どもたちをプログラミングの世界に紹介したいが、どうやって知らなかったお父さんやお母さんオタクがたくさんいる」という事実に帰する。 おそらく、 Hello Rubyの成功は、プログラマーのニーズの高まりに関係しています。英国では、基本的なカリキュラムにプログラミングが追加されているため、彼らはすでに不足しています。



デジタルテーマの本のアイデアはかなり奇妙に見えるようです-この場合、モバイルアプリケーションはより良く適合しませんか? しかし、リンダは、子供たちがスクリーンの前ですべての時間を過ごすべきではないと考えています。 彼女は、世界を変えるためのツールとしてコンピューターを使用する方法を熟考するために、子供たちがもっと時間を費やすことを望んでいます。 「子供たちに紙でコンピューターを作るか、手でアプリケーションを描くように頼みます。 想像力がすべてです。」



Lindaは将来のRubyアドベンチャーに取り組んでいます。 近年、新しいジュリアPLがアメリカに登場し、名声を高めています。 リンダは彼を彼女の本に含めたいと思っています。 「ジュリアはルビーのガールフレンドです。」



彼女がWired雑誌の会議で話したとき、私はリンダに会いました。 過去数年にわたって、彼女はそのような会議の最年少参加者だったので、CyFiという仮名の下で13歳の少女がステージに上がり、盗まないように「良いハッカー」であると人々に教える方法を伝えたとき、彼女はとても幸せでしたデータはサイトを破壊しませんが、脆弱性を探し、所有者にこれについて警告します。 「私はもう最年少の話者ではないという事実に慣れなければなりません」とリンダは笑います。 「この少女は最高でした。」



リンダは、女性プログラマーの数の増加を女性の技術分野への回帰と考えています。 「これはすべて、男性がプログラミングに適しているというフィクションです。 Ada Lovelaceは最初のプログラマーでした。 彼女はバイロンLordの娘であり、母親は数学者でした。 彼女が最初のプログラミング言語を作成するのに役立ったのは、これらのルーツ、詩、数字でした。」



現在、米国では、プログラマの80%が男性です。 リンダは、この職業が高い報酬と非常に創造的なものであることが明らかになった後にのみ、この職業を占有したと考えています。



彼女の意見では、問題はソフトウェア業界が社会のニーズを反映していないということです。 「20歳以上の男の子は女の子や友人との出会いで問題を解決してきましたが、世界には他の問題がたくさんあります」と彼女は言います。



リンダは自分自身を社会の本質を変える波の頂点と考えています。 「1970年代には、パンクが登場し、そのパンクで全世代が成長しました。 私たちの世代はソフトウェアの世代です。 1行のコードで何百万人もの人々の生活に影響を与えることができます。」



All Articles